Rep. Bennie Thompson (D-MS), Ranking Member of the House Committee on Homeland Security, testifies at a Rules Committee meeting on H. Res. 863, a resolution introducing articles of impeachment against Secretary of Homeland Security Alejandro Mayorkas, Washington, DC, February 5, 2024. Rep. Marjorie Taylor Greene (R-GA) introduced the resolution in November, 2023, accusing Mayorkas of ‘high crimes and misdemeanors’ concerning the U.S. border with Mexico. The House is expected to vote on the resolution in the next two days.
